Understanding Unwanted Call Laws in Mississippi
In Mississippi, including Tupelo, the Do Not Call Law aims to protect residents from unwanted telemarketing calls. This law gives consumers the right to opt-out of receiving marketing calls and imposes strict regulations on call centers. If your phone number is registered on the state’s “Do Not Call” list, it’s illegal for businesses to contact you without prior consent.
The Mississippi Unfair or Deceptive Acts Law also plays a significant role in curbing unwanted calls. This law prohibits companies from engaging in deceptive practices, including making prerecorded or automated calls to individuals who have registered their numbers on the national “Do Not Call” registry. Understanding these laws is crucial when considering filing a lawsuit against relentless unwanted call campaigns targeting your Tupelo residence.
Eligibility Criteria for Filing a Lawsuit
In Tupelo, MS, filing a lawsuit against unwanted calls is a viable option for individuals who have consistently been violated by phone solicitation or telemarketing calls. To be eligible to file a lawsuit, you must first establish that the calls were indeed unsolicited and that they violated your rights under state laws. Specifically, the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A) prohibits calls made using an Auto-Dialer or prerecorded messages without prior express consent from the recipient. If these criteria are met, individuals can seek legal action against the offending party, which could include a do not call law firm in Mississippi.
Additionally, to file a successful lawsuit, you should have documented evidence of the calls, such as call records or voice mail messages, and be able to prove that the calls caused you harm or disruption. The laws in Mississippi offer protections for consumers from these intrusive and unwanted calls, ensuring that individuals can enjoy peace of mind without constant harassment from telemarketers.

The Legal Process of Filing a Suit
When you decide to take legal action against unwanted calls, understanding the process is key. The first step involves gathering evidence, such as records of the calls, including dates, times, and any identifying information provided by the caller. You can use these to prove that the calls were indeed unsolicited and a violation of your privacy rights.
Once you have your evidence, you’ll need to consult with a lawyer who specializes in consumer protection or telecommunications law. They will guide you through the specific legal process in Mississippi, which may include filing a complaint with the appropriate regulatory body, such as the Mississippi Attorney General’s Office, and ultimately, if settlement negotiations fail, filing a lawsuit against the offending party. Remember, seeking professional legal advice is crucial when dealing with such matters to ensure your rights are protected throughout the process.
